BHUBANESWAR: Union Minister of State for Environment and Forests Jairam Ramesh reiterated today that the final approval for diversion of forest land for Polavaram (Indira Sagar) project is subject to compliance of several conditions by the Andhra Pradesh Government and the user agency concerned. Stop work order in POSCO dated 04th August 2010 with regard to diversion of 1253.225 ha of forest land for establishment of Integrated Steel Plant and Captive Port by POSCO-India Pvt. Ltd., Jagatsinghpur district of Orissa.

The status report on implementation of the Scheduled tribes and other traditional forest dwellers act, 2006 by the states. Provides details of claims received, titles distributed and the extent of forest land for which titles distributed (individual and community) for major states till 30th June 2010. A Joint Committee of the Ministry of Environment & Forests (MoEF) and Ministry of Tribal Affairs has been reconstituted to study in detail the implementation of the Forest Rights Act, 2006, including factors that are aiding and impeding its implementation.
